Train

Hampton Jitney

If you are flying into Islip, you will need to take a short (~10 min) uber/lyft/taxi to get to the bus from the airport. When purchasing your Hampton Jitney bus ticket, select the Islip Airport Connection (AIE) - Eastbound stop as your pickup point. Select a drop-off of Greenport (GP), which will be right at the ferry. If you are flying into LaGuardia, you will need to take a ~20 minute uber/lyft/taxi to get to the bus from the airport. When purchasing your Hampton Jitney bus ticket, select the Queens Airport Connection Eastbound (APE) stop as your pickup point. Select a drop-off of Greenport (GP), which will be right at the ferry. If you are flying into JFK, you will need to take a ~40 minute uber/lyft/taxi to get to the bus from the airport. When purchasing your Hampton Jitney bus ticket, select the Queens Airport Connection Eastbound (APE) stop as your pickup point. Select a drop-off of Greenport (GP), which will be right at the ferry.

Discount Code - Pre-pay online ahead of time to save $8 each way

Train

Long Island Rail Road

If you are flying into LaGuardia, search the schedule from Woodside to Greenport. Woodside is a quick uber/lyft/taxi ride away from the airport, and there are train lines that will take you to Greenport (with a transfer at Ronkonkoma), dropping you off right at the ferry. If you are flying into JFK, search the schedule from Jamaica to Greenport. You will take the "AirTran" from JFK to the Jamaica Station. There, a train line will take you to Greenport (with a transfer at Ronkonkoma), dropping you off right at the ferry.

Travel Note

Shelter Island Ferry

Please note that you will need to take either the North Ferry from Greenport (8 minute ride) or the South Ferry from North Haven (5 minute ride) to get onto Shelter Island. You may drive across or walk across. Bring cash for the ferry rides. No reservations required. See their websites for rates and schedules. There is a Chase on Shelter Island in the center of town if you need cash while on the island. North Ferry website: https://www.northferry.com South Ferry website: https://www.southferry.com
